Chongqing Hotpot: This is what I want.
Chongqing people are addicted to eating hot pot. Calling friends, gathering in hot pot and drinking a case of beer are the daily life of Chongqing people.
Northerners call hot pot "shabu-shabu". A copper pot is filled with clear water, with a few slices of onion, ginger and medlar floating on it, and a few slices of mutton and beef are sandwiched with paper-thin chopsticks. Wrap it in sesame sauce and fermented bean curd before the entrance, and sprinkle a few cloves of sugar and garlic to make the food fresh and tender. The hot pot in Chongqing is bright red and shiny, and the foam is rolling. Put a plate of yellow throat hairy belly, pour a basket of bean sprouts and green bamboo shoots, order a large bottle of Wei Yidou milk, and open half a dozen beers with a shiny garlic dish. The important thing is to be bold and carefree.
Needless to say, the origin of hot pot is not as elegant as instant-boiled mutton or the emperor's hospitality to centenarians. To put it bluntly, this is a creative move by the dock boatmen to fill their hunger after work. Hometown people's obsession with hot pot is also because they eat and drink alike, and they are hearty and hearty when eating hot pot.
Chongqing's hot pot pays attention to old oil and old soup, old oil is boiled with butter, and old soup is slowly boiled with old hen soup. This old oil soup has been criticized for its hygiene in recent years, but it tastes better. There is no doubt that if you occasionally eat guests' "leftovers" at the dinner table, you should not be too serious.
Chongqing people are very talented in studying food. The old family used all the ingredients to rinse the hot pot, which is the most famous joke on the Internet. When something comes out, Chongqing people laugh: "Use it to rinse hot pot!" Although exaggerated, it also stems from the love of hot pot. Cann't get used to Chili? You can eat Yuanyang pot. Red soup pot is boring to eat, as well as fish hotpot, beef hotpot and rabbit hotpot.
You can eat hot pot in the open air and in rainy days, set up a table in the river ditch to eat hot pot, and it is unusual to open a "hole hot pot" in the air raid shelter, just like in the movie "Hot Pot Hero", with a wide greasy black bench, a white tile stove and an old shade tea. Chongqing people: honest and frank Zhanyi brothers.
Some people say that the character of Chongqing people is like this boiling hot pot, burning, honest and frank, and full of enthusiasm. In Chongqing dialect, close friends are called "brothers". After drinking several glasses of beer and eating a hot pot, they got acquainted, met each other after a brief encounter, scrambled to pay the bill, and made an appointment to have a drink and dinner together next time. Chongqing people often say "non-existent" and "very flat", which is similar to "a piece of cake" and "can do it" in Mandarin. It shows the loyalty and heroism of Chongqing people and exudes a simple and heavy Jianghu atmosphere.
